What is new baby eating and how much? What color is the diarrhea, is it watery, does it have an odor? Go to pedialyte for now for a few feedings, but it may be disease, the food, or amount your feeding depending on your answers:)
lovemypetsquirrels
09-01-2012, 03:52 PM
3cc's every 4-5 hours of goat milk/yogurt without cream
light brown/mustard watery no smell
pappy1264
09-01-2012, 03:57 PM
Ok, start back up with pedialtye, whether she seems dehdrated or not. It will help her to get out what is in there. She weighs 119.7 grams (per your 4.2 ounces). She should be getting 5.95 cc's per feeding (that is 5% of her weight, as she does better you can go up as high as 7%, but for now, stick with the 5%). How much yogurt did you put in with the gm? If you put too much, and she is not used to that, it could give her diarrhea. Give a couple feedings of pedialyte, then make up the gm/yogurt, but dilute it with some water (for her size, I would start at 50/50 gm formula to water in the syringe for a couple of feedings, then go to 75/25 gm to water for a couple). Feed every 4 hours and see how she does with that.
